Output 698aa6469a51f20b2a56b4528c7c828cdbf792cfeb49f83f85659c9a4b732874:0

value
2960900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0235703cd576147d8d4c5834cc95f01bba73fef2 OP_EQUAL
address
31thHtqMmXHtZuZ6ysdNnUiaMwysdpovvX
transaction
698aa6469a51f20b2a56b4528c7c828cdbf792cfeb49f83f85659c9a4b732874
confirmations
199995
spent
true